Warning Signs You Need Floor Water Damage Restoration

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Putrid smells can be a sign of underlying water damage. If you notice a persistent musty odor, it’s time to call in the experts. Don’t ignore it, it could mean further damage is on the horizon.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

Water-damaged flooring can cause buckling or warping. If you notice any changes in your flooring’s texture or appearance, it’s essential to act quickly. Don’t wait, call us today to schedule a consultation.

Staining or Discoloration

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Willow Park, TX

The cost of floor water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. In general,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for minor water damage, and up to $5,000 or more for larger-scale damage. Our team will provide a free consultation and estimate to ensure you get the right solution for your needs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of flooring
Dehumidification and equipment rental $200 – $1,000 Duration of drying process and type of equipment used
Deep cleaning and disinfecting $100 – $500 Type of cleaning products used and extent of cleaning required

The exact cost of floor water damage restoration will depend on the specifics of your situation.
